Marko
PronunciationSerbo-Croatian: [mâːrko]
GenderMale

Marko is a masculine given name, a cognate of Mark.

In Croatia, the name Marko was the second most common masculine given name in the decades between 1980 and 1999, and third most common 2000–2011. [1]
